How to Arrange Fruit for a Graduation Celebration

Arranging fruit for a graduation celebration is a fun and creative process that can steal the show. I absolutely love starting with a big platter that can hold all the colorful fruits and give enough room for creativity. 

When choosing fruits, I always choose a variety of colors and textures—think watermelon, strawberries, blueberries, pineapple, and grapes. The vibrant mix will instantly catch the eye!

For a fun twist, cut the fruits into bite-sized pieces for easy snacking (and so no one has to wrestle with a giant slice of watermelon).

One of my favorite tricks is creating patterns or even shapes, like a graduation cap, using blackberries for the cap and pineapple slices for the brim. It’s such a cute, thematic touch that adds to the festive vibe.

If you’re feeling extra fancy, consider layering your fruits in a tiered arrangement!

It looks impressive and gives the platter a more dynamic feel. Also, don’t forget to use smaller fruits like blueberries or grapes to fill in the gaps! The key is to make it look full and bountiful so your guests feel like they’re about to dive into a colorful feast. 

Plus, it’s the perfect way to showcase the natural beauty of fresh fruit while keeping everything super simple. The goal? A platter that’s as delicious as it is visually stunning!

Graduation Fruit Tray Pairings: What to Serve with Fruit

Okay, now that the fruit platter looks amazing, it’s time to take it up a notch by pairing it with the perfect dips and snacks! I’m all about adding a variety of dips to complement the fruits’ natural sweetness. 

First up: a creamy yogurt dip. It’s super easy to make—mix plain yogurt with a bit of honey or vanilla extract—and it pairs beautifully with almost every fruit on your platter.

I’m not going to lie, I adore chocolate fondue. There’s something magical about dipping strawberries, pineapple, or apple slices into warm, rich chocolate.

It’s a guaranteed crowd-pleaser! If you want a more savory twist, cheese is your friend. I love adding cubes of sharp cheddar or brie to balance out the sweet fruit, and it’s such a hit with guests. This graduation charcuterie board has a great mix of cheeses and fruits.

You can even throw in some crackers or crostini for that satisfying crunch everyone loves. 

Want to add some crunch on the sweeter side? Try sprinkling some granola over the fruit—it’s so simple but adds the perfect texture contrast. Oh, and don’t forget to include a few nuts, like almonds or walnuts! 

They’re an unexpected but delightful addition that elevates the platter. Honestly, there’s no wrong way to pair fruit with these delicious sides—just have fun with it.
